Andrea Čunderlíková: The Colorful Life of the “Colorless” Sister from Hospital on the Outskirts of the City

While Czech Television is commemorating its seventy years of existence with the controversial series “Volha”, giving the impression that this institution was staffed only by people who filmed nothing but normalization propaganda, drank themselves into unconsciousness, had sex and abused each other, it simultaneously broadcasts a number of films, series and entertainment programs that were created at that time and the real creative and acting elite took part in them. Among them is the legendary series “Hospital on the outskirts of the city”.

His extraordinary qualities are also evidenced by his great success abroad. Producers from Hamburg television even contributed to the fact that after the first, thirteen-part series from 1979, a second, seven-part series was filmed two years later. Thanks to this, the main characters experienced unexpected and unprecedented popularity not only in our country, but also abroad. For example, Eliška Balzerová, who won the prestigious TV award “Bambi” for her role as Dr. Čeňková, recalls that when she was on holiday abroad, people recognized her and literally went crazy. Josef Abrhám, on the other hand, was surprised by the German fans of “Hospital” in Paris.

Unforgettable Ina

And even after decades, many actors are primarily associated with this series. This also applies to the beautiful and shy sister Ina Galušková, played by Andrea Čunderlíková. Although she created dozens of other roles, all were overshadowed by this one, truly fateful. She has already made it known many times that she didn’t like the character of an infantile and closed girl at all at first and initially she didn’t want to play her at all, because she herself is the exact opposite of her. It was only years later, thanks to several interviews, that she managed to convince the audience that she really had nothing in common with Ina except for beauty. She was similarly reluctant to play her in “The Hospital After Twenty Years”, mainly because she hadn’t appeared on camera in twenty years. The role of Dr. Blažej’s wife in “Hospital after twenty years” thus became her last ever.

Colorless little sister?

In 2011, Andrea Čunderlíková appeared as an almost sixty-year-old elegant lady in the “Jan Krause Show”. He also recalled that she is well known as Ina from “Hospital” and added: “She was such a colorless nurse,” against which, however, Andrea objected: “That’s not true, she got everything she wanted.” And when Kraus (a classmate of Andrea’s from elementary school, by the way) objected that she was absent-minded, she blasted him: “Well, maybe that’s why.” She boasted that the role made men like her while women hated her.

She revealed to viewers what she actually did after she ended her acting career. Because she didn’t want to wait for roles after 1989, she started working as a manager in the tennis industry, after all her daughter Sandra Kleinová was a very successful tennis player. During the interview, she vividly demonstrated that she is very far from the sleepy and infantile Ina, that she is, on the contrary, lively, talkative and that she does not lack a great sense of humor.

Better death than retirement

Last year, in an interview with Czech Radio, she told how important filming “Hospital on the Edge of the City” was for her and how fantastic the atmosphere was: “Back then, filming was still done in a different way, much more was devoted to it. I enjoyed being in that studio and watching the bards. It was very enlightening for me and I look back on it fondly.” Although he has long been entitled to a pension, he still works (this time in the field of public relations) and does not think about resting at all: “You must kill me before I retire.” She also mentioned that she is very happy and the two granddaughters who were born to Sandra give her the greatest joy.
